首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何获取要保存在firestore中的复选框的值?

要获取保存在Firestore中的复选框的值,可以通过以下步骤实现:

  1. 在前端页面中,使用HTML和JavaScript创建一个包含复选框的表单。确保每个复选框都有一个唯一的ID和一个相应的标签。
  2. 使用JavaScript代码获取复选框的值。可以通过使用document.getElementById()方法来获取每个复选框的DOM元素,然后使用checked属性来判断复选框是否被选中。例如:
代码语言:txt
复制
var checkbox1 = document.getElementById("checkbox1");
var checkbox2 = document.getElementById("checkbox2");

var checkbox1Value = checkbox1.checked;
var checkbox2Value = checkbox2.checked;
  1. 将获取到的复选框的值保存到Firestore中。可以使用Firestore提供的API将复选框的值保存到指定的集合和文档中。首先,确保已经初始化了Firestore实例,并且已经创建了一个集合和文档用于保存数据。然后,使用set()方法将复选框的值保存到指定的文档中。例如:
代码语言:txt
复制
var firestore = firebase.firestore();

firestore.collection("collectionName").doc("documentId").set({
  checkbox1: checkbox1Value,
  checkbox2: checkbox2Value
})
.then(function() {
  console.log("复选框的值已成功保存到Firestore中");
})
.catch(function(error) {
  console.error("保存复选框的值到Firestore时出错:", error);
});

在上述代码中,collectionName是要保存数据的集合的名称,documentId是要保存数据的文档的ID。checkbox1Valuecheckbox2Value是前面获取到的复选框的值。

需要注意的是,上述代码中使用了Firebase的Firestore服务来保存数据到云端。Firestore是一种云原生的NoSQL文档数据库,适用于实时数据同步和离线应用。如果你想了解更多关于Firestore的信息,可以访问腾讯云的Firestore产品介绍页面

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分33秒

088.sync.Map的比较相关方法

22分0秒

产业安全专家谈 | 企业如何进行高效合规的专有云安全管理?

7分1秒

086.go的map遍历

2分25秒

090.sync.Map的Swap方法

5分40秒

如何使用ArcScript中的格式化器

1时29分

企业出海秘籍:如何以「稳定」产品提升留存,以AIGC「创新」实现全球增长?

9分19秒

036.go的结构体定义

6分9秒

Elastic 5分钟教程:使用EQL获取威胁情报并搜索攻击行为

7分13秒

049.go接口的nil判断

56分38秒

Techo Youth高校公开课:技术新青年应该知道的N件事

6分6秒

普通人如何理解递归算法

5分25秒

046.go的接口赋值+嵌套+值方法和指针方法

领券